The "Unable to connect to background process" and "Unable to submit to queue" messages are common errors that unfortunately have many causes.
Before you do anything else, check that your version of Compressor is compatible with your operating system. Compressor 2.1 and 3.0 are compatible with OS X 10.5; Compressor 3.0, 3.5 and 4.0 are compatible with OS X 10.6; and Compressor 3.5 and 4 are compatible with OS X 10.7. If you have an incompatible earlier version, you will need to either upgrade Final Cut Studio or downgrade your operating system
Try the following steps:
1. In Compressor, go to Compressor > Reset Background Processing.
2. Run Compressor Repair.

3. Trash Compressor preferences (can also be done in Compressor Repair).

Do the following if nothing else works:
4. Disable your internet / network connections.
5. Reinstall Compressor and Qmaster.

6. Perform a full erase and install of the operating system and reinstall from scratch.
